About Course

The specialization Software and Systems Engineering of the Master 2 in Computer Engineering aims to train professionals capable of designing, structuring, and managing complex software systems. It emphasizes software engineering methods, computer system architecture, software component integration, and mastery of application environments. This training is part of a rigorous academic framework, focused on a deep understanding of the software systems used in modern organizations.

This specialization prepares graduates to hold high-responsibility positions in the fields of software development and management of computer systems. Graduates can advance to positions of software engineer, designer analyst, application architect, software systems manager, or IT project manager. It also provides a solid foundation for careers in digital services, public administrations, technology companies, or organizations requiring robust information systems.The training offers a sharp specialization while maintaining strong coherence with the foundations of computer engineering. It allows for structured skill enhancement, adapted to distance learning, and centered on the real requirements of professional software systems. It promotes intellectual autonomy, the ability to analyze complex architectures, and mastery of software design methods, while ensuring excellent academic continuity with the Bachelor's and Master's cycles.

Course Content

FOURTH YEAR

Semester 7 – 30 credits

UE 2: Software Systems Engineering

UE 2 : Ingénierie des systèmes logiciels

UE 3: Internet Technologies and Applications

Semester 8 – 30 credits

UE 4: Advanced Networks and Systems

UE 5: Advanced Security of Computer Systems

UE 6: University Methodology and Digital Tools in Computer Engineering

FIFTH YEAR

Semester 9 – 30 credits

UE 1: Advanced Software Architecture

UE 2: Advanced Software Engineering

UE 3: Complex Computer Systems

Semester 10 – 30 credits

UE 4: Information Systems Engineering

UE 5: Security and Reliability of Systems

UE 6: Defense
